First Sunday of Advent - Hope (read Psalm 25:1-10)



The Advent wreath is a circular garland of evergreen branches representing eternity. On that wreath, five candles are typically arranged. During the season of Advent one candle on the wreath is lit each Sunday as a part of the Advent services. Each candle represents an aspect of the spiritual preparation for the coming of the Lord, Jesus Christ.
Set on the branches of the wreath are four candles: three purple candles and one pink candle. In the center of the wreath sits a white candle. As a whole, these candles represent the coming of the light of Christ into the world.
On the first Sunday of Advent, the first purple candle is lit. This candle represents hope or expectation in anticipation of the coming Messiah.
On the second Sunday of Advent, the second purple candle is lit. This candle typically represents love.
On the third Sunday of Advent the pink, or rose-colored candle is lit. This pink candle is customarily represents joy.
The fourth and last purple candle, represents peace and is lit on the fourth Sunday of Advent.
On Christmas Eve, the white center candle is traditionally lit. This candle is called the "Christ Candle" and represents the life of Christ that has come into the world.

JUST ENOUGH for The Journey - CHRISTIANS DON'T BELIEVE IN FATE, WE BELIEVE IN THE LIVING GOD!

Horoscope or Astrology is defined as a forecast of a person's future, typically including a delineation of character and circumstances, based on the relative positions of the stars and planets at the time of that person's birth.

The idea behind Astrology or fortune-telling is the idea of a "fixed fate", an unchanging future that is already laid out and cannot be changed. This not scriptural!

Satan has deceived people into thinking that they can know the future. In his cleverness, he has many "fooled" into believing "what will be, will be", and in doing so, this "foolishness" by "foolish" folks have "fooled" themselves into "falling" for a "fatalistic" attitude toward life!

We serve a Loving, Living, Life-changing God! He changes our residence from hell to Heaven. He changes our status from sinner to Saint. He changes our torment to Triumph. He changes our relationships from severed to Stong. He changes our pity to Praise and our worry to Worship!

As Christians we are not bound by fate, we are Victorious, Blessed, Favored, Renewed, Revived, Powerful, Perfected, Promoted, Lifted, Gifted, Healed, Restored and Protected by THE FATHER!!!

Don't be FOOLED by your daily "Horror-scope", this is witchcraft controlled by Satan. You were created by a creative God to be a creative Being made in His image and in His likeness. Fate is a negative connotation which means events that are beyond your control, yet Christ said that He has come so that you may have LIFE and not only life, but an ABUNDANT LIFE!

Today and every day claim victory in Christ Jesus and don't fall for the trickery of the Devil. No man can tell me what God has in store for my day or for my life! I get my daily bread, my strength and my hope from God. BTW, if you truly want to affect your future in a positive way, receive Christ and then everything about you will change!

"There shall not be found among you anyone who makes his son or his daughter pass through the fire, or  one who practices witchcraft, or a soothsayer, or one who interprets omens, or a sorcerer, or one who conjures spells, or a medium, or a spiritist, or one who calls up the dead. For all who do these things are an abomination to the Lord , and because of these abominations the Lord your God drives them out from before you. You shall be blameless before the Lord your God." (Deuteronomy 18:10-13 NKJV)

JUST ENOUGH for The Journey - Three Basic Elements of Prayer

This morning's Sunday School Lesson in case we don't have it because of our Consecration Service:

When they had been released, they went to their own companions and reported all that the chief priests and the elders had said to them. And when they heard this, they lifted their voices to God with one accord and said, "O Lord, it is You who MADE THE HEAVEN AND THE EARTH AND THE SEA, AND ALL THAT IS IN THEM, who by the Holy Spirit, through the mouth of our father David Your servant, said, 'WHY DID THE GENTILES RAGE, AND THE PEOPLES DEVISE FUTILE THINGS? 'THE KINGS OF THE EARTH TOOK THEIR STAND, AND THE RULERS WERE GATHERED TOGETHER AGAINST THE LORD AND AGAINST HIS CHRIST.' "For truly in this city there were gathered together against Your holy servant Jesus, whom You anointed, both Herod and Pontius Pilate, along with the Gentiles and the peoples of Israel, to do whatever Your hand and Your purpose predestined to occur. "And now, Lord, take note of their threats, and grant that Your bond-servants may speak Your word with all confidence, while You extend Your hand to heal, and signs and wonders take place through the name of Your holy servant Jesus." And when they had prayed, the place where they had gathered together was shaken, and they were all filled with the Holy Spirit and began to speak the word of God with boldness. (Acts 4:23-31 NASB)

1.) WHO HE IS:  "O Lord, it is You who MADE THE HEAVEN AND THE EARTH AND THE SEA, AND ALL THAT IS IN THEM

When you're feeling pressured, when you're being threatened, it's always a good idea to start prayer by remembering to whom you're talking. Sometimes my problems seem so big and insurmountable until I start to worship and remember WHO HE IS - the Creator of all things.

2.) WHAT IS HAPPENING: "For truly in this city there were gathered together against Your holy servant Jesus, whom You anointed, both Herod and Pontius Pilate, along with the Gentiles and the peoples of Israel, to do whatever Your hand and Your purpose predestined to occur."

In Psalm 2, Father, the believers prayed, "You told us that the heathen would try to come against You and Your people - We acknowledge that this is all in accordance with Your will. David wrote in Psalm 73 that the heathen seem to prosper while the Godly suffer.  Peter said, "Think it not strange when fiery trials come upon you" (1 Peter 4:12)

When persecution comes, it is in accordance with the Word and the will of the Father

3.) WHY WE COME:  "And now, Lord, take note of their threats, and grant that Your bond-servants may speak Your word with all confidence, while You extend Your hand to heal, and signs and wonders take place through the name of Your holy servant Jesus."

The early church didn't pray that they might have a break from persecution, but that they might have boldness in persecution.

THE RESULT: And when they had prayed, the place where they had gathered together was shaken, and they were all filled with the Holy Spirit and began to speak the word of God with boldness.

We often pray when we are shaken up. These guys prayed so they could BE SHAKEN UP!!!
